We present the power spectrum of the reconstructed halo density field derived from a sample of luminous red galaxies (LRGs) from the Sloan Digital Sky Survey (SDSS) Seventh Data Release (DR7). The halo power spectrum has a direct connection to the underlying dark matter power for k 0.2 h Mpc -1 , well into the quasi-linear regime. This enables us to use a factor of 8 more modes in the cosmological analysis than an analysis with k max = 0.1 h Mpc -1 , as was adopted in the SDSS team analysis of the DR4 LRG sample.
